Many nations want to pressure the North Korean government into halting the further development of nuclear weapons. Some nations

want the leadership of the country to change entirely. What would put the MOST pressure on the North Korean economy and political leaders?
A, increased tariffs

B, a free trade agreement

C reduced quotas

D, an embargo on all trade

It is believed that Paul was a martyr. Which answer best describes what this means?
pav-90 [236]
When someone is described as a "martyr", all this means is that this person died for a cause they they believed in, and that their death inspired others to follow in the cause in question, often in the face of opposition.
